What are the main responsibilities of a Machine Learning/AI Architect?
The main responsibilities of a Machine Learning/AI Architect include owning the implementation and deployment of AI models and systems, collaborating with cross-functional teams to understand business requirements, designing and developing AI architectures and algorithms, evaluating and selecting AI technologies, tools, and frameworks, optimizing AI models for performance and scalability, developing and maintaining AI pipelines, conducting code reviews, and staying up to date with the latest advancements in AI technologies.
